CMA CGM, a global leader in shipping and logistics, is inviting applications from eligible candidates for its Assessment Internship โ€“ June 2025 Batch. The internship aims to groom a new generation of professionals who understand the nuances of maritime law, logistics, and claims management.

Who is Eligible?
To be considered for this internship, you must be:

  • A fresh graduate or final-year student enrolled in:
    • A three-year or five-year law course, or
    • A shipping or logistics program from a recognized institution

This opens doors for candidates from both legal and maritime academic backgrounds to explore a niche yet dynamic career track in maritime claims, compliance, and shipping operations.

What Does the Program Involve?

The Assessment Internship at CMA CGM is not your usual internship. It is a full-time, six-month intensive training program, structured to simulate actual professional work environments. The training will be divided into two primary components:

  1. In-Class Training โ€“ Gain theoretical knowledge of international maritime law, commercial contracts, claims handling, and shipping regulations.
  2. On-the-Job Training โ€“ Work alongside seasoned professionals and participate in real case handling, risk assessment, and dispute resolution related to shipping claims.

By the end of this internship, candidates will be industry-ready and capable of handling complex scenarios within the maritime legal domain.

About the Role

As a Legal Associate, you will be a key part of YES BANKโ€™s wholesale banking legal team. The position focuses on managing complex legal frameworks related to domestic and cross-border lending, ensuring regulatory compliance, and safeguarding the bankโ€™s legal interests through expert documentation and advisory.

You will be responsible for reviewing and drafting high-value financial agreements aligned with international standards, coordinating with top law firms, and supporting business units in ensuring legally compliant operations. This is a high-responsibility role offering significant exposure to domestic and global financial markets.

Key Responsibilities

As part of the Legal Associate Job in India, your core duties will include:

  • Drafting, negotiating, and reviewing a broad range of lending and security documents for both domestic and cross-border transactions using APLMA and LMA documentation standards.
  • Liaising with leading external legal counsels, both Indian and international, to finalize documentation for overseas or structured financing deals.
  • Providing legal support for the International Banking Unit (IBU) and business teams by vetting process notes, policies, product terms and conditions.
  • Advising on legal and regulatory issues related to wholesale banking operations, cross-border financing, and structured lending.
  • Monitoring regulatory developments and providing timely advisories to ensure internal policies and business decisions are aligned with evolving legal standards.
  • Collaborating with internal teams such as compliance, credit, and treasury to ensure smooth functioning of financial operations from a legal standpoint.

Ideal Candidate Profile

To be successful in this Legal Associate Job in India, the ideal candidate must have a blend of academic excellence and relevant legal experience in the banking or finance domain. Hereโ€™s what YES BANK is looking for:

  • LL.B. degree from a recognized Indian law college. A Masterโ€™s degree (LL.M.), particularly with international exposure or foreign qualifications, is highly preferred.
  • 4โ€“8 years of post-qualification experience (PQE) working in a reputed law firm or as in-house legal counsel at a scheduled commercial or foreign bank.
  • Expertise in Indian lending laws, creation of security interests, enforcement actions, and banking law compliance.
  • Hands-on experience with APLMA / LMA-standard documentation for cross-border lending and syndicated loans.
  • A clear understanding of regulatory and statutory frameworks applicable to wholesale banking in India, including guidelines from the RBI, FEMA, and SEBI.
  • Strong analytical and drafting skills, with the ability to translate legal complexity into actionable guidance for business teams.
  • Excellent interpersonal and communication skills to coordinate with internal departments and external advisors effectively.
  • Proven ability to handle tight deadlines and multitask in a high-stakes, fast-paced banking environment.
